Tail index estimation matlab download

Definitions definition of heavytailed distribution. Using extreme value theory and copulas to evaluate market. We then get the socalled maximum likelihood estimators of the tail index in this paper, we are interested in the derivation of the asymptotic. The system identification toolbox software uses linear, extended, and unscented kalman filter, or particle filter algorithms for online state estimation. You can generate matlab code from the tool, and accelerate parameter estimation using parallel computing and simulink fast restart. Tables 5 and 6 present the numerical results on the performance of ols estimators in regressions 1. Citeseerx document details isaac councill, lee giles, pradeep teregowda. If you need to investigate a robust fitted regression model further, create a linear regression model object linearmodel by using fitlm. This report is stored in the report property of the estimated model. This includes their representation as matlab objects, evaluation. Predictor data in the regression model, specified as the commaseparated pair consisting of x and a matrix the columns of x are separate, synchronized time series, with the last row containing the latest observations. Pdf asymmetric least squares estimation and testing. High volatility, thick tails and extreme value theory in.

On robust tail index estimation under random censorship. The hacopula toolbox extends the copula modeling provided by matlab to modeling with hierarchical archimedean copulas, which allows for nonelliptical distributions in arbitrary dimensions enabling for asymmetries in the tails. Improving the accuracy of statistical models can involve estimating. Maximum likelihood estimation open live script the mle function computes maximum likelihood estimates mles for a distribution specified by its name and for a custom distribution specified by its probability density function pdf, log pdf, or negative log likelihood function. Pricing american basket options by monte carlo simulation. All these methods assume that the sample set under consideration obeys a levy stable distribution. It is obvious that estimating powerlaw exponents from data is a task that sometimes should. You can find additional information about the estimation results by exploring the estimation report, sys. Online estimation algorithms update model parameters and state estimates when new data is available. In section 3, we describe the method for estimating the mean when the underlying distribution is. Operands, specified as scalars, vectors, matrices, or multidimensional arrays. An element of the output array is set to logical 1 true if both a and b contain a nonzero element at that same array location.

This example shows how to estimate nonseasonal and seasonal trend components using parametric models. Source of the number of range estimates to report, specified as auto or property. The generalized pareto gp is a rightskewed distribution, parameterized with a shape parameter, k, and a scale parameter, sigma. This topic shows how to specify estimation options in the parameter estimation tool. This note provides simulation results for garch processes and estimators of the tail index using harmonic numbers discussed in section 3. For other distributions, a search for the maximum likelihood must be employed.

When you supply distribution functions, mle computes the parameter estimates using an iterative maximization algorithm. Note that assumption rl is quite general and is satis. Tail index is the key parameter for distributions with regularly varying tail. This object uses the viterbi algorithm and a channel estimate to equalize a linearly modulated signal that has been transmitted through a dispersive channel. Mar 30, 2008 in statistics of extremes, inference is often based on the excesses over a high random threshold. Tail index estimation 26012012 arthur charpentier 7 comments these data were collected at copenhagen reinsurance and comprise 2167 fire losses over the period 1980 to 1990, they have been adjusted for inflation to reflect 1985 values and are expressed in millions of danish kron. The resulting estimators are simple to construct, and they can be generalized to address other rate estimation problems as well. In probability theory, heavytailed distributions are probability distributions whose tails are not exponentially bounded. With some models and data, a poor choice of starting point can cause mle to converge to a local optimum that is not the global maximizer, or to fail to converge entirely.

The tail index shape is in this case more accurate less variance, but. Matex matlab extremes file exchange matlab central. A survey on computing levy stable distributions and a new. Credit ratings rank borrowers according to their credit worthiness. If you set this property to auto, the number of reported estimates is determined from the number of columns in the detidx input to the step method. When you have a fitted model, check if the model fits the data adequately. In particular, point and interval estimates of the tail risk measures are computed. You can perform online parameter estimation and online state estimation using simulink blocks and at the command line. Goodness of fit criteria cost function the cost function is a function that estimation methods minimize. Display estimation results of vector autoregression var. The most popular estimator for the tail index of heavy tailed distributions is the hill 1975 estimator. You can refer to getting started with matlab to hdl workflow tutorial for a more complete tutorial on creating and populating matlab hdl coder projects run fixedpoint conversion and hdl code generation. Adaptive threshold selection in tail index estimation.

The step method outputs y, the maximum likelihood sequence estimate of the signal. Parameter estimation plays a critical role in accurately describing system behavior through mathematical models such as statistical probability distribution functions, parametric dynamic models, and databased simulink models. Given a dataset, this software estimates the length of the tail dependence, the number of patterns of extreme values and the patterns with their relative. Accordingly, inhibitors of the akt regulator phosphatidylinositol3kinase completely blocked gdnftriggered akt phosphorylation and a.

The time series is monthly accidental deaths in the. The generalized central limit theorem has that the sum of independent, identically and symmetrically distributed random variables converges to a distribution whose tail is pareto, with 0 matlab functions to estimate the tail index, the parameter of the pareto distribution. Fitting a parametric distribution to data sometimes results in a model that agrees well with the data in high density regions, but poorly in areas of low density. Matlab code can be integrated with other languages, enabling you to deploy algorithms and applications within web, enterprise, and production systems. Several approaches have been proposed to estimate parameters of levy stable distribution, including tail index estimation, quantile estimation, empirical characteristic function method and maximum likelihood ml estimation. Mlseequalizer creates a maximum likelihood sequence estimation equalizer mlsee system object, h. Matlab helps you take your ideas beyond the desktop. Specify your distribution choice in the model property distribution the innovation variance. For details on types of files and data supported by simbiology, see supported files and data types. Simbiology lets you import tabular data and visualize and preprocess it.

For conditional variance models, the innovation process is. Get bottom rows of table, timetable, or tall array matlab tail. The mle function computes maximum likelihood estimates mles for a distribution specified by its name and for a custom distribution specified by its probability density function pdf, log pdf, or negative log likelihood function for some distributions, mles can be given in closed form and computed directly. A software package for extreme value analysis in matlab. The estimation report contains information about the results and options used for a model estimation. Estimation of transition probabilities introduction. After you have specified estimation data and parameters, specify the following estimation options. These pareto tail objects encapsulate the estimates of the parametric pareto lower tail, the nonparametric kernelsmoothed interior, and the parametric pareto upper tail to construct a composite semiparametric cdf for each index. The object processes input frames and outputs the maximum likelihood sequence estimate mlse of the signal. An application of extreme value theory for measuring financial. Tail index estimation for degree sequences of complex networks. Under status, fit to estimation data shows that the estimated model has 1stepahead prediction accuracy above 75% you can find additional information about the estimation results by exploring the estimation report, sys.

The following code segment creates objects of type paretotails, one such object for each index return series. This example shows how to generate hdl code from a basic leadlag timing offset estimation algorithm implemented in matlab code. In other words, estimate cannot estimate an intercept of a regression model with arima errors that has nonzero degrees of seasonal or nonseasonal integration. The output displays the polynomial containing the estimated parameters alongside other estimation details. Using extreme value theory and copulas to evaluate market risk. Given the exceedances in each tail, optimize the negative loglikelihood function to estimate the tail index zeta and scale beta parameters of the gpd. Matlab functions to estimate the tail index, the parameter of the pareto distribution. Under status, fit to estimation data shows that the estimated model has 1stepahead prediction accuracy above 75%. High volatility, thick tails and extreme value theory in valueatrisk estimation. Those excesses are approximately distributed as the set of order statistics associated to a sample from a generalized pareto model. Estmdl estimatemdl,y,params0,name,value estimates the statespace model with additional options specified by one or more name,value pair arguments. Y steph,x equalizes the linearly modulated data input, x, using the viterbi algorithm.

This estimator necessitates a choice of the number of. The calculations are displayed in the command window of matlab. A read is counted each time someone views a publication summary such as the title, abstract, and list of authors, clicks on a figure, or views or downloads the fulltext. In many applications it is the right tail of the distribution that is of interest, but a distribution may have a heavy left tail, or both tails may be heavy. Online estimation algorithms estimate the parameters and states of a model when new data is available during the operation of the physical system. You can run your analyses on larger data sets, and scale up to clusters and clouds. Today everything can be bought online through mobiles and internet.

The mlseequalizer object uses the viterbi algorithm to equalize a linearly modulated signal through a dispersive channel. The display includes a table of parameter estimates with corresponding standard errors, t statistics, and pvalues. Though this ranking is, in itself, useful, institutions are also interested in knowing how likely it is that borrowers in a particular rating category will be upgraded or downgraded to a different rating, and especially, how likely it is that they will default. To create a model of multiple time series data, decide on a var model form, and fit parameters to the data. Maximum likelihood estimation for conditional variance. Estimation of the shape parameter of a generalized pareto. Simultaneous tail index estimation 21 assumptionr l. Autoregressive psd object to function replacement syntax. For the summary of supported algorithms and fitting options, see supported methods for parameter estimation in simbiology. Matlab simulation online matlab simulation online gives you a complete knowledge about matlab simulation. This matlab function returns maximum likelihood estimates mles for the.

Equalize using maximum likelihood sequence estimation. If you pass in such a model for estimation, estimate displays a warning in the command window and sets estmdl. Modelling tail data with the generalized pareto distribution. Generalized pareto parameter estimates matlab gpfit mathworks. Therefore, the hill estimator indicates a powerdecaying tail with an exponent of 2. In statistics of extremes, inference is often based on the excesses over a high random threshold. Fit robust linear regression matlab robustfit mathworks. The stable portion of this figure implies a tail index estimate of 0. Maximum likelihood estimation for conditional variance models. The distribution of a random variable x with distribution function f is said to have a heavy right tail if the moment generating function of x, m x t, is infinite for all t 0 that means. The performance of the estimation of the tail index of the gpd. The summary also includes the loglikelihood, akaike information criterion aic, and bayesian information criterion bic model fit statistics, as well.

Learn about the burg, yulewalker, covariance, and modified covariance methods of parametric spectral estimation. Replace calls to autoregressive psd objects with function calls. This processing uses an estimate of the channel modeled as a finite impulse response fir filter. Inputs a and b must either be the same size or have sizes that are compatible for example, a is an mbyn matrix and b is a scalar or 1byn row vector.

For more information, see compatible array sizes for basic operations. These paretotails objects encapsulate the estimates of the parametric gp lower. The optimization problem solution are the estimated parameter values. Estimation of confidence intervals for the mean of heavy tailed loss. Simulation in matlab is the best and effective way to bring out your projects due to its graphical features and advanced visualization support. The corresponding algorithms were presented and can be downloaded as matlab code. Generalized pareto parameter estimates matlab gpfit. Matlab simulation online matlab simulation online offers you a complete support for matlab simulation based projects, assignments, mini projects and lab exercises. The tail index is the shape parameter of these heavy tailed distributions. Pdf on robust tail index estimation under random censorship. The software formulates parameter estimation as an optimization problem.

If cluster ids are provided, the number of estimates is determined from the number of unique cluster ids in the clusterids input to the step method. Specify your distribution choice in the model property distribution. For example, you can specify to deflate the observations by a linear regression using predictor data, control how the results appear in the command window, and indicate which estimation method to use for the parameter covariance matrix. A new approach on tail index estimation is proposed based on studying the insample evolution of appropriately chosen diverging statistics. Fitting powerlaws in empirical data with estimators that work for all. The time series is monthly accidental deaths in the u. Maximum likelihood estimation for conditional variance models innovation distribution. Matthys, tail index estimation and an exponential regression model. The sample period is 3 january 1983 to 31 december 1996.

291 958 534 995 1306 949 790 853 110 1641 1151 1573 207 1072 43 843 826 1369 151 644 1497 1475 1189 441 1445 1172 1372 1625 737 1195 955 76 353 56 1308 998